The aim of the work is to disclose specific breathing exercise program’s effects to 14-17 years - old children who are sick with bronchitis. To reveal the research goals were risen: to review breathing exercises importance to adolescent who have bronchitis basing on scientific literature analysis; applying Štangės, Henšo and thorax flexibility tests to examine and compare experimental and control group children’s lung functional capacity before and after physiotherapy application; to test and rate stomach and torso side muscles strength before and after specific breathing exercises program’s application in that way setting experiment’s effect and benefits for children. In this research thirty Palangos rehabilitation sanatorium “Palangos Gintaras” patients participated. It was 14-17 years’ old teenagers, who are sick with bronchitis. There was made two kind of groups: experimental and control in which the numbers of kids were the same. In experimental group it was needed to reveal specific breathing exercises effects on stomach, torso side muscles strength, lungs functional possibilities, thorax flexibility. In experimental group breathing exercises has been adapted two times per day. In control group ordinary physiotherapy activities happened. Full textThere are plenty of epidemiological researches reveal that, exposure to air pollution is associated with numerous effects on human health. The association of PM 10 with the prevalence of bronchitis among till 5 years old children was examined in a cross-sectional study. We found out that, average seasonal pm 10 concentration varied from 20 µg/m3 till 41 µg/m3. And average pm 10 concentration and counted in every year varied from 24 µg/m3 till 33 µg/m3. The highest average yearly pm 10 concentration was determined in Petrašiūnai 2010 and 2011 years. Also we found out that, the prevalence of bronchitis between 5 years old children was higher in Petrašiūnai (69%). The prevalence of bronchitis in Dainava was 49 %. Controlling the factors perverting connection we found out that, smoking and indoor smoking also deficiency of D vitamin have the tendency to increase the risk of bronchitis. In conclusion, we found that, children who lived and used to go to kindergartens in Petrašiūnai the risk of the bronchitis was 2,9 (PI 95 % 1,789 – 4,716).

Full textThe hypothesis that asthmatic patients draw their attention away from bodily processes and show inaccurate interoception with regard to relevant airway obstructions was tested in this study. Additionally, we examined whether this postulated withdrawal of attention can also be generalized for the perception of non-airway related symptoms as well as for private self-consciousness. Accuracy of interoception was measured as the discrepancy between subjective judgement of obstruction and objective obstruction as shown in spirometric tests. Other variables were operationalized by self-reports. Ninetyone patients in a rehabilitation hospital were tested: 30 asthmatic patients, 30 patients with chronic obstructive bronchitis (COB), and 31 control subjects without any airway disease. Asthmatic patients showed attention withdrawal only with regard to bronchial airways. However, they also indicated an overestimation of airway obstruction. Surprisingly, deviant results were also found for the COB patients including underestimation of obstructions and lower self awareness. All results were interpreted from the perspective of behavioral medicine
